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ies
These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ies are a delightful twist on the classic chocolate chip cookie, combining the sweet burst of cherries with rich chocolate for a truly indulgent treat!
Ingredients:
– 1 cup all-purpose flour
– 1/2 tsp baking soda
– 1/4 tsp salt
– 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
– 1/2 cup brown sugar
– 1/4 cup granulated sugar
– 1 large egg
– 1 tsp vanilla extract
– 1/2 cup chocolate chips
– 1/2 cup dried cherries, chopped
Directions:
1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. In a small b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
3. In a separate mixing bowl, cream together the but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
4. Beat in the egg and vanilla extract until well combined.
5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just incorporated.
6. Fold in the chocolate chips and chopped cherries until evenly distributed.
7. Use a cookie scoop to portion out the d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each cookie.
8. Bake for 10-12 minutes or until the edges are lightly golden.
9.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
Prep Time: 15 minutes | Cooking Time: 10-12 minutes | Total Time: 25-27 minutes | Calories: ~130 per cookie | Servings: 12 cookies | Storage Tips: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
